Spring Soup — Vegan Spring Vegetable Soup with White Beans (Cozy, Reliable, Weeknight-Ready)

Quick Facts

Time: 60 minutes • Yield: 4–6 servings • Skill: Easy • Method: One-pot stovetop • Diet: Vegan, DF, GF (with GF stock)

Introduction

Spring Soup is the perfect bridge between chilly evenings and warmer days—comforting enough to warm you up, yet loaded with crisp-tender vegetables that celebrate the season. This riff channels classic spring minestrone: asparagus, peas, greens, and soft potatoes, anchored by white beans for creaminess and protein. The broth stays light and fragrant, with a gentle herbal note and optional pesto swirled in at the end for color and brightness. It’s ideal for families, meal prep, or anyone who wants a wholesome pot that’s easy to customize and easier to love.

For more bright, vegetable-forward bowls, skim our Spring Soup Recipes next.

Why You’ll Love It

  • Weeknight-easy: mostly hands-off simmering and simple prep.
  • Flexible: swap greens, beans, or add tiny pasta if you like.
  • Balanced flavor: savory broth, sweet peas, fresh herb finish.
  • Great leftovers: tastes even better on day two.
Whisk edaf16d80ed948eb32743786ae97f7ebdr

Spring Soup — Vegan Spring Vegetable Soup with White Beans

This cozy vegan spring soup balances hearty comfort and seasonal freshness, combining asparagus, peas, greens, and potatoes in a light herbal broth with creamy white beans. One pot, weeknight-friendly, and deeply customizable.
Course: Main, Soup
Cuisine: Seasonal, Vegan
Calories: 280

Ingredients
  

  • 2 Tbsp extra-virgin olive oil
  • 6 green onions, sliced (whites separated from greens)
  • 2 large garlic cloves, minced (or green garlic, sliced)
  • 1 lb baby potatoes, cut into 1-inch chunks
  • 1 15-oz can diced tomatoes (with juices)
  • 4 cups low-sodium vegetable stock
  • 0.5 lb artichoke hearts, roughly chopped (fresh or frozen, optional)
  • 1 15-oz can chickpeas or cannellini beans, rinsed and drained
  • 1 cup peas (fresh or frozen)
  • 0.5 lb asparagus, cut into 1-inch pieces
  • 2 cups greens (spinach, chard, kale), thinly sliced
  • 0.25 cup plant-based pesto (up to)
  • 1 tsp freshly ground black pepper
  • Sea salt to taste
  • Lemon wedges, for serving (optional)

Equipment

  • Dutch oven (5–6 qt) Distributes heat evenly and keeps potatoes intact.
  • wooden spoon Protects delicate vegetables.
  • ladle For serving and optional blending.
  • blender (optional) To blend a cup for creamier texture.

Method
 

  1. Warm oil over medium heat. Add the white parts of the green onions and garlic; stir until fragrant. This lays a gentle, savory foundation.
  2. Stir in potatoes, then tomatoes and stock. Bring to a simmer; season lightly with salt. Simmer until potatoes are just tender—fork meets slight resistance.
  3. Add artichoke hearts (if using) and cook briefly so they absorb the broth.
  4. Stir in beans and peas; return to a gentle simmer.
  5. Add asparagus; cook until bright green and crisp-tender. Fold in sliced greens just until wilted.
  6. Off heat, swirl in pesto to taste. Season with pepper and adjust salt. Serve with lemon for a clean, bright pop.

Nutrition

Calories: 280kcalCarbohydrates: 38gProtein: 12gFat: 9gSaturated Fat: 1gPolyunsaturated Fat: 1gMonounsaturated Fat: 6gSodium: 460mgPotassium: 950mgFiber: 9gSugar: 6gVitamin A: 3200IUVitamin C: 27mgCalcium: 120mgIron: 4mg

Notes

Add pesto and delicate greens at the end to keep flavors bright. For creaminess, blend a portion of the soup or stir in plant yogurt. Stores well for meal prep and tastes even better the next day. Use frozen peas, canned beans, and prewashed greens to save time.

Tried this recipe?

Let us know how it was!

Ingredients

  • 2 Tbsp extra-virgin olive oil
  • 6 green onions, sliced (whites separated from greens)
  • 2 large garlic cloves, minced (or green garlic, sliced)
  • 1 lb baby potatoes, 1-inch chunks
  • 1 (15-oz) can diced tomatoes (with juices)
  • 4 cups low-sodium vegetable stock
  • ½ lb artichoke hearts (fresh or frozen), roughly chopped (optional)
  • 1 (15-oz) can chickpeas or cannellini beans, rinsed and drained
  • 1 cup peas (fresh or frozen)
  • ½ lb asparagus, 1-inch pieces
  • 2 cups greens (spinach, chard, kale), thinly sliced
  • Up to ¼ cup pesto (plant-based)
  • 1 tsp freshly ground black pepper
  • Sea salt to taste
  • Lemon wedges, for serving (optional)

What each ingredient does:
Olive oil: carries aroma. Green onion & garlic: savory backbone. Potatoes: soft, satisfying body. Tomatoes: gentle acidity and color. Stock: liquid base. Artichokes: springy depth. Beans: creaminess and protein. Peas: sweetness. Asparagus: bright crunch. Greens: freshness. Pesto: herbaceous finish. Pepper/lemon: lift and balance.

Must-have vs. flexible: Must-have: stock, aromatics, potatoes, beans, peas, asparagus. Flexible: tomatoes, artichokes, greens, pesto.

Pro tip: Add delicate greens and pesto last to keep flavors bright.

Substitutions & Swaps

  • Aromatics: Use ½ a medium onion if you’re out of green onions.
  • Beans: Cannellini, Great Northern, or chickpeas all work.
  • Greens: Spinach melts in; kale holds texture.
  • Starch: Sub a handful of small pasta; simmer separately if you prefer it al dente.
  • Diet notes: Everything is dairy-free; ensure pesto is plant-based.
  • Time savers: Use frozen peas and prewashed greens; opt for canned beans.

Equipment Notes

A 5–6 qt Dutch oven distributes heat evenly and keeps potatoes intact. A ladle blender is nice for partially blending a cup of soup if you want a creamier body (optional). Wooden spoon for gentle stirring helps protect delicate asparagus tips.

Step-by-Step

  1. Sauté the base (2–3 min): Warm oil over medium heat. Add the white parts of the green onions and garlic; stir until fragrant. This lays a gentle, savory foundation.
  2. Add potatoes & liquids (10 min): Stir in potatoes, then tomatoes and stock. Bring to a simmer; season lightly with salt. Simmer until potatoes are just tender—fork meets slight resistance.
  3. Layer hardy spring veg (5 min): Add artichoke hearts (if using) and cook briefly so they absorb the broth.
  4. Beans & peas (5 min): Stir in beans and peas; return to a gentle simmer.
  5. Asparagus & greens (3–4 min): Add asparagus; cook until bright green and crisp-tender. Fold in sliced greens just until wilted.
  6. Finish (1 min): Off heat, swirl in pesto to taste. Season with pepper and adjust salt. Serve with lemon for a clean, bright pop.

Doneness cues: Potatoes tender but not crumbling; asparagus crisp-tender; greens just wilted; broth lightly glossy with pesto.

Whisk cfda584a4e9381091b14233f16941c3cdr
Spring Soup — Vegan Spring Vegetable Soup with White Beans (Cozy, Reliable, Weeknight-Ready) 3

Make-Ahead, Storage & Reheating

  • Make-ahead: Slice onions, trim asparagus, and cube potatoes (store potatoes in water up to 24 hours).
  • Fridge: 3–4 days; the broth gets more flavorful.
  • Freeze: 2–3 months; add greens and pesto fresh after thawing for best texture.
  • Reheat: Low simmer on the stovetop; splash in water or stock to loosen.

How to Lighten / Make It Creamy

  • Lighter: Reduce potatoes by one third and add more asparagus and peas.
  • Creamier: Blend 1 cup of soup (mostly beans + potatoes) and stir back in; or whisk in a spoonful of unsweetened plant yogurt off heat. Temper to avoid curdling.

Toppings, Garnishes & Finishes

Top with chopped parsley or dill, a lemon squeeze, or a drizzle of olive oil. For crunch, add toasted breadcrumbs or roasted chickpeas. A tiny swirl of extra pesto on each bowl looks gorgeous.

Sides & Pairings

Great with warm bread, a crisp green salad, or herbed couscous. Sparkling water with lemon or a light herbal iced tea keeps it refreshing.

Scaling the Recipe

Double in a larger pot; add asparagus in batches so it doesn’t overcook. Halve by cutting everything evenly and reduce simmer time slightly. Cool big batches quickly in shallow containers.

Nutrition & Dietary Notes

Beans supply plant protein and fiber; peas add vitamin-rich sweetness; greens provide iron and folate. Choose low-sodium stock and season at the end for control.

Troubleshooting

  • Too salty? Dilute with unsalted stock and finish with lemon.
  • Too bland? Salt, pepper, and a bit more pesto; simmer 1 minute to bloom flavors.
  • Too watery? Reduce uncovered for a few minutes or blend a small portion.
  • Veg too soft? Add a handful of fresh peas and herbs at serving for texture.

FAQs

Can I use frozen or precut veggies? Yes—frozen peas and cut asparagus work well; add late.
Best bean choice? Cannellini for creaminess; chickpeas for bite.
How do I avoid mushy potatoes? Keep the simmer gentle and pieces even.
Dairy-free/gluten-free? It’s dairy-free; confirm plant-based pesto and GF stock.
How long does it keep? Up to 4 days refrigerated; 2–3 months frozen (add greens/pesto later).

Variations

  • Lemony Herb: Add zest and juice of ½ lemon and a shower of parsley.
  • Spicy Chipotle: Stir in a pinch of chipotle flakes; balance with a touch of maple.
  • Creamy “Parmesan”-Style: Blend a ladle and finish with a spoon of nutritional yeast for savory depth.

Chef Notes / Test Kitchen Tips

Build the soup in stages—this protects textures and keeps colors vibrant. Hold back delicate greens and pesto until the last minute. Taste after the pesto goes in; it’s salty and herbal, so final seasoning should be gentle.

Conclusion

This Spring Soup brings peak-season vegetables to a cozy, reliable bowl you can serve on any weeknight. It stores well, reheats with ease, and welcomes your favorite greens or beans. Ladle it up, note your favorite tweaks, and file it under Spring Soup Recipes you’ll make on repeat.

For more cozy bowls that reheat well, bookmark our Soup Recipes.

LEAVE A REPLY

Recipe Rating




Please enter your comment!
Please enter your name here


Latest Recipes

Must Try

More Recipes Like This